About Simon Grill

Simon Grill is a scholar working on Molecular Biology, Pediatrics, Perinatology and Child Health, Infectious Diseases, Cardiology and Cardiovascular Medicine and Pulmonary and Respiratory Medicine, having authored 16 papers that have together received 780 indexed citations. Recurring topics across this work include Prenatal Screening and Diagnostics (4 papers), Blood groups and transfusion (2 papers), Pregnancy and preeclampsia studies (2 papers), Pulmonary Hypertension Research and Treatments (2 papers), Enzyme Structure and Function (2 papers), Folate and B Vitamins Research (1 paper), Glycosylation and Glycoproteins Research (1 paper) and Cancer Genomics and Diagnostics (1 paper). The work is most often cited by research in Obstetrics and Gynecology (221 citations), Pediatrics, Perinatology and Child Health (232 citations), Infectious Diseases (90 citations), Clinical Biochemistry (31 citations) and Hematology (43 citations). Simon Grill has collaborated with scholars based in Switzerland, Germany and United States. Frequent co-authors include Sinuhe Hahn, Matthias Mack, Wolfgang Holzgreve, Olav Lapaire, Rosanna Zanetti‐Dällenbach, Sevgi Tercanli, Corinne Rusterholz, Xiao Yan Zhong, Oliver Schilling and C. Vogl. Their work appears in journals such as British Journal of Clinical Pharmacology, Journal of Bacteriology, Fetal Diagnosis and Therapy, Frontiers in Pediatrics and Archives of Gynecology and Obstetrics.
